Citibank Doesn\’t Want Your Business, Linux Users

2009-11-03 1 min read Linux Uncategorized

This is an article from the Citibank customers in US.

The Consumerist: &#8221;Citibank won&#8217;t let customers using Linux computers log in to their online accounts. Adam argues that in 2009 this doesn&#8217;t make sense, especially when no other major corporate website blocks him like this.&#8221;

Metasploit Project Sold To Rapid7

2009-10-29 1 min read Uncategorized

[ad]

ancientribe writes &#8221;The wildly popular, open-source Metasploit penetration testing tool project has been sold to Rapid7, a vulnerability management vendor, paving the way for a commercial version of Metasploit to eventually hit the market. HD Moore, creator of Metasploit, was hired by Rapid7 and will continue heading up the project. This is big news for the indie Metasploit Project, which now gets full-time resources. Moore says this will translate into faster turnaround for new features. Just what a commercial Metasploit product will look like is still in the works, but Rapid7 expects to keep the Metasploit penetration testing tool as a separate product with &#8217;high integration&#8217; into Rapid7&#8217;s vulnerability management products.&#8221;
